Probate & Inheritance in Clark County

Navigating inherited property in Winchester through probate can be complex and time-consuming. In Nevada, the probate process can take anywhere from six months to over a year, depending on the estate's size and complexity. Estates valued under $100,000 may qualify for a simplified "set aside" process, but larger estates require formal administration, involving court supervision.

Dealing with the Clark County Clerk and the Eighth Judicial District Court adds layers of paperwork and potential delays. Beneficiaries often face the burden of maintaining a property they don't want, paying taxes, and covering utility costs like NV Energy bills, all while waiting for court approval. Foreclosure in Nevada

Facing foreclosure in Winchester is a stressful situation, but there are options. Nevada primarily uses a non-judicial foreclosure process, which can be swift. Once a Notice of Default (NOD) is recorded, homeowners typically have a 90-day period to cure the default. After this period, a Notice of Sale (NOS) can be issued, followed by a sale date usually within 20 days.

This compressed timeline means swift action is crucial. Many homeowners in Winchester fail to realize how quickly their property can be lost. Winchester Neighborhoods: A Local's Guide

Winchester, an unincorporated town in Clark County, Nevada, shares its vibrant energy with the greater Las Vegas metropolitan area. It's a place where diverse communities meet, offering different living experiences while all falling under the umbrella of the Clark County School District (CCSD) and providing proximity to the Las Vegas job hub. Understanding the nuances of its specific neighborhoods is key to appreciating Winchester's unique character.

Paradise Palms

Often considered an architectural treasure, Paradise Palms is known for its mid-century modern Ranch style homes. Developed primarily in the 1960s, these homes boast unique designs and larger lots than many newer developments. Residents here often face the common challenge of maintaining older homes, including the potential for Slab Leaks from original plumbing. Despite these issues, the neighborhood's charm and design appeal are strong. It's popular among those seeking a more established community feel and quick access to the Strip and downtown Las Vegas via arterial roads like Desert Inn Road.
